What's The Definition Of Pride?
pride
uncountable noun: Pride is a feeling of satisfaction which you have because you or people close to you have done something good or possess something good. uncountable noun: Pride is a sense of the respect that other people have for you, and that you have for yourself. uncountable noun: Someone's pride is the feeling that they have that they are better or more important than other people. verb: If you pride yourself on a quality or skill that you have, you are very proud of it.
